DAYTIME RUNNING LAMPS (IF EQUIPPED)
WARNING: Always remember to turn on your headlamps at
dusk or during inclement weather. The Daytime Running Lamp
(DRL) system does not activate the tail lamps and generally may not
provide adequate lighting during these conditions. Failure to activate
your headlamps under these conditions may result in a collision.
The system will turn the front fog lamps on in low light situations.
The following conditions must be met to activate this feature:
• Switch the ignition on.
• Switch the lighting control to the off, autolamp or parking lamp
position.
• The transmission must be in a gear other than P (Park).
